English

Noun

N.

  1. Abbreviation of north.
  2. (grammar) Abbreviation of nominative case.

Adjective

N.

  1. Abbreviation of northern.

Usage notes

This is the customary abbreviation of this term as used in case citations. See, e.g., The Bluebook: A Uniform System of Citation, Nineteenth Edition (2010), "Case Names and Institutional Authors in Citations", Table T6, p. 430-431.
